I found out about Breidablik through Jordsjø. Jordsjø was just added to Prog Archives, and for good reason. Jordsjø released a split cassette album with Breidablik called Songs From the Northern Wasteland (title inspired by Michael Hoenig's Departure from the Northern Wasteland, no doubt). As it turns out, Breidablik had released material totally independent of Jordsjø, and the music is nothing like the Änglagård, Wobbler and White Willow-style symphonic prog of Jordsjø, but inspired by the Berlin School of electronic music, like Tangerine Dream and Klaus Schulze. It's a one-man act lead by Waldemar Hoppschnagel, someone I don't know much about, and can't seem to find much background info on him, but of course he plays everything you hear here, which are synths. Although Breidablik did release a couple of EPs for download on Bandcamp, they (or he, I should say) did release a full cassette in 2017 called Vinter, which is also on Bandcamp (it can also be downloaded). I had just downloaded Vinter, and ordered the cassette, and I'm glad to discover Breidablik. From listening to this, it's pretty safe to say this is firmly Progressive Electronic. There was one mistake regarding Breidablik and that it was Morten Birkland Nielsen who is the man behind Breidablik. I got the wrong name from Discogs in the description, but his name is included in the credits as an ANV in the Songs from the Northern Wasteland entry. Also when I ordered the cassette to Vinter it clearly states Morten Birkland Nielsen was Briedablik in my email.

Thanks for the kind words and for ordering the cassette. It was shipped today :-) 

My new full-lengt album "Penumbra" will be released digitally at Bandcamp and as limited edition LP on Pancromatic Records later this autumn. Containing four songs spanning more than 40 minutes it will be bigger and much better than the earlier albums, but the music is still deeply rooted in the Berlin School of Electronic Music. 

Tracklist: 
1. Penumbra pt. I (19:30) 
2. Penumbra pt. II (11:08) 
3. Nehalennia (04:35) 
4. The chariots of the sun (05:15)

Pancromatic Records is a label by the Tormod Opedal who had Uniton Records in the 1980s. Uniton was responsible for albums by Berlin School artists such as Mark Shreeve, Rolf Trostel, and Conrad Schnizler so it is a great honor for me to release an album on this new label. 

Btw. Waldemar Hoppschnagel is a pseudonym/joke (inspired by Edgar Froese, Adelbert von Deyen and so on), and meant as an attempt to stay anonymous. Well, I guess the cat is already out of the bag ;-)
